Blue flag is a herb commonly used by the Native Americans for treating constipation and inducing vomiting. The scientific name of this herb is Iris versicolor; it is a perennial herb grown mainly in the central and eastern regions of North America. The rhizome of blue flag is known for its acrid and pungent taste and strange odor. Psoriatic arthritis is the form of arthritis occurring in patients suffering from psoriasis. A large section of the patients with psoriasis develop this arthritis form as the effect of this skin disorder. However, in rare cases, one might also develop psoriatic arthritis without being affected by psoriasis earlier. The common signs of psoriatic arthritis include swelling, stiffness and pain in the ailing joints; patients often experience these signs in all parts of their body.
